Quick explanation: |
13 |
|
14 |
ISO/IEC prefixes [1,2]: KiB (kibibyte), MiB (mebi-), GiB (gibi-) |
15 |
-- unambiguously 2^10, 2^20, 2^30 |
16 |
|
17 |
'old' prefixes: kB (kilobyte), MB (mega-), GB (giga-) |
18 |
-- can mean 10^3 or 2^10 etc. depending on author's intention |
19 |
-- SI people tend to use 10^N for consistency with other units |
20 |
|
21 |
Major FLOSS projects have already started using binary prefixes: |
22 |
the Linux kernel and GNU coreutils (e.g. df). They are used in e.g. |
23 |
pacman as well, and I've submitted patches for portage already. |
